Hi Yordan,

While writing my presentation I found a few slight issues that we need
to address.

 1. Need to show the task in the info window when hovering over the CPU
    plot between events, but not idle

 2. Is there a way to do a quick zoom out. When I zoom in with a lot of
    data, I find that it's quite slow to zoom back out to the original
    screen.

 3. We need a "File exists, do you want to overwrite" type dialog box
    when saving a session over a file that already exists.

 4. When restoring a session, the full path of the file being loaded
    should be shown. I noticed this because I was loading a trace.dat
    file from a different directory, and I wasn't sure which file it
    found, as I have several trace.dat files.

 5. I noticed a glitch when loading a session with both the A and B
    markers are set here only one marker was shown in the list view.
    I can put the session and trace.dat file someplace that you can
    test this if you want.
